About the Film
During a weekend trip to the countryside, Laura, a young piano student from Berlin, miraculously survives a shocking car accident. When she regains consciousness in a nearby house, Laura is cared for by a local woman who looks after her with motherly devotion. As she recovers, Laura begins to settle into the lives of the woman and her initially reserved husband and son. Sometimes haunted by memories, sometimes full of hope, Laura and her adoptive family find their way back into the world and discover a strange harmony together. But they cannot escape the ghosts of the past, which begin to stir, as acclaimed director Christian Petzold (PHOENIX, TRANSIT) tells a modern Gothic fairy tale about the lies we tell ourselves and the strange ways in which grief, connection, and humanity bind us together and strengthen us.
Director: Christian Petzold
Germany, 2025, 86 min., in German and French with English subtitles, digital
